什么是编程指数运算方法

fiy 其他 20

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    编程指数运算方法是一种用于计算数学问题答案的算法。它是根据指数运算的数学规则和编程语言的特性设计的。下面将详细介绍编程指数运算方法的原理和几种常见的实现方法。

    编程指数运算方法的原理是基于指数运算的数学定义,即将一个数(基数)重复乘以自身多次。在编程中,可以使用循环结构来实现指数运算。具体来说,可以通过循环将基数不断地乘以自身,循环的次数为指数。例如,2的3次方等于2乘以2乘以2,可以用循环实现。

    在实际编程中,可以使用多种方法来实现指数运算。以下是几种常见的实现方法:

    1. 使用循环:可以使用for循环或while循环来实现指数运算。循环的次数为指数,每次循环都将基数与结果相乘。例如,在Python中可以这样实现:
    def power(base, exponent):
        result = 1
        for i in range(exponent):
            result *= base
        return result
    
    1. 使用递归:递归是一种将问题分解成更小规模子问题的方法。可以使用递归来实现指数运算。具体来说,可以将指数运算分解为基数乘以指数-1次方的运算。例如,在Java中可以这样实现:
    public static int power(int base, int exponent) {
        if (exponent == 0) {
            return 1;
        } else {
            return base * power(base, exponent - 1);
        }
    }
    
    1. 使用内置函数:许多编程语言都提供了内置的指数运算函数,可以直接调用这些函数来实现指数运算。例如,在C++中可以使用pow函数:
    #include <cmath>
    #include <iostream>
    
    int main() {
        int base = 2;
        int exponent = 3;
        int result = pow(base, exponent);
        std::cout << result << std::endl;  // 输出8
        return 0;
    }
    

    综上所述,编程指数运算方法是一种用于计算数学问题答案的算法,可以通过循环、递归或者调用内置函数来实现。选择何种方法取决于具体的编程语言和问题需求。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    编程指数运算方法是一种用于计算和分析编程相关的数据指标的数学方法。它主要通过对编程中的不同方面进行量化和统计分析,来评估和比较不同的编程项目、编程语言、编程技术等的性能、复杂度和效率等指标。

    以下是编程指数运算方法的几个重要特点和应用示例:

    1. 度量代码复杂度:编程指数运算方法可以通过分析代码的行数、循环次数、嵌套层数和条件语句的数量等来计算代码的复杂度指标。这有助于开发人员评估和改进他们的代码质量,并优化程序的执行效率。

    2. 比较不同编程语言的性能:编程指数运算方法可以用于比较不同编程语言的性能指标,如执行速度、内存占用等。通过对相同任务在不同编程语言下的实现进行比较,可以选择最适合特定需求的编程语言。

    3. 分析代码的可维护性:编程指数运算方法可以通过对代码中的注释行数、命名规范、代码冗余度等指标进行评估和分析,来评估代码的可读性、可维护性和易扩展性。这有助于开发人员改进代码的可理解性和可维护性,并降低代码出错的风险。

    4. 预测项目的工作量:编程指数运算方法可以通过对项目的需求和功能进行分析,来预测项目的工作量和开发时间。通过定量评估不同功能点的开发复杂度和涉及的代码量等指标,可以为项目管理提供更准确的工作量评估和进度安排。

    5. 评估开发者的编程能力:编程指数运算方法可以通过分析开发者的代码风格、代码复杂度和代码质量等指标,来评估开发者的编程能力和水平。这有助于雇主在招聘和项目分配时做出更准确的决策,提高团队的整体效能。

    综上所述,编程指数运算方法在软件开发和编程领域具有广泛的应用,可以帮助开发人员评估和改进代码质量、比较编程语言的性能、预测项目工作量等,对于提高代码质量、加速开发进程和优化资源利用具有重要意义。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    编程指数运算方法是一种基于指数函数的计算方法,常用于编程中进行指数运算。指数运算是数学中的一种重要运算方法,它表示将某个数(被称为底数)乘以自身若干次(指数)的运算。编程中的指数运算可以用来进行数据转换、算法设计以及模型构建等方面的操作。

    下面将从基本概念、操作流程和应用实例三个方面进行详细介绍编程指数运算方法。

    一、基本概念

    1. 底数(Base):底数是指指数运算中被乘的数,通常是一个实数。
    2. 指数(Exponent):指数是指指数运算中指定要乘以底数的次数,通常是一个整数。指数可以为正数、负数或零。
    3. 指数函数(Exponential Function):指数函数是以实数为底的指数函数,通常表示为y = a^x,其中a为底数,x为指数。

    二、操作流程
    进行编程指数运算时,可以按照以下步骤进行操作流程:

    1. 定义底数和指数:根据具体的问题需求,定义底数和指数的数值。
    2. 使用指数函数进行运算:利用编程语言内置的指数函数或自己编写指数函数进行运算。一般来说,常用的指数函数有Math.pow()、cmath.pexp()等。
    3. 根据需求获取结果:根据具体的问题需求,获取指数运算结果并进行进一步处理和应用。

    三、应用实例
    编程指数运算方法广泛应用于科学、工程和金融等领域。以下是一些常见的应用实例:

    1. 数值计算:在数值计算中,指数运算常用于求解复利问题、模拟物理现象、拟合曲线等。例如,可以通过指数运算计算存款利息、模拟放射性衰变过程等。
    2. 算法设计:在算法设计中,指数运算可以用于提高算法效率和模型的准确性。例如,通过指数运算可以设计更快速的幂运算算法、优化排序算法等。
    3. 数据转换:在数据转换中,指数运算可以用于将数据进行归一化或者还原。例如,常用的指数转换方法包括对数转换、平方根转换等。
    4. 模型构建:在机器学习和统计建模中,指数运算常用于构建模型和分析数据。例如,可以通过指数运算构建指数回归模型、指数平滑模型等。

    总结:
    编程指数运算方法是一种基于指数函数的计算方法,通过定义底数和指数,利用指数函数进行运算,可以应用于数值计算、算法设计、数据转换和模型构建等领域。编程指数运算方法在编程过程中发挥重要作用,可以帮助解决各种实际问题和优化算法效率。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部